What is a USA Cybersecurity Law Firm?
A USA cybersecurity law firm is a legal practice that focuses on laws, regulations, and disputes related to digital security, data protection, and cybercrime.
These firms provide specialized legal services in areas such as:
- Data breach response and litigation
- Cybersecurity compliance (HIPAA, GDPR, CCPA, etc.)
- Digital privacy law advisory
- Ransomware attack legal response
- Cybercrime defense and prosecution support
- IT risk management consulting
- Corporate cybersecurity governance

Benefits of Hiring a USA Cybersecurity Law Firm
1. Legal Protection Against Data Breaches
Cybersecurity attorneys help companies respond quickly and legally to breaches. This includes:
- Investigating breach source
- Notifying affected users
- Handling regulatory reporting
- Defending against lawsuits
2. Regulatory Compliance Assurance
Businesses must comply with laws such as:
- HIPAA (healthcare data)
- GDPR (international data protection)
- CCPA (California privacy law)
- SOX compliance (financial reporting)
Cybersecurity law firms ensure full compliance to avoid fines.
3. Ransomware and Cybercrime Defense
If a company is attacked, lawyers assist with:
- Negotiating ransomware demands (when legally appropriate)
- Coordinating with law enforcement
- Minimizing legal exposure
- Recovering damages
4. Risk Management and Prevention
These firms also offer proactive services:
- Cybersecurity policy development
- Employee data handling training
- Vendor risk assessments
- IT contract review
5. Litigation Support
If cyber incidents lead to lawsuits, cybersecurity attorneys provide:
- Court representation
- Evidence collection
- Expert witness coordination
- Settlement negotiation

Cost of USA Cybersecurity Law Firm Services
The cost depends on case complexity, company size, and legal requirements.
1. Hourly Rates
- Small firms: $250 – $500/hour
- Mid-tier firms: $400 – $800/hour
- Top-tier firms: $800 – $1,500+/hour
2. Retainer Fees
Many businesses use monthly retainers:
- Small business: $2,000 – $10,000/month
- Medium business: $10,000 – $50,000/month
- Enterprise: $50,000+ /month
3. Incident Response Costs
For data breaches:
- Simple breach: $10,000 – $50,000
- Complex breach: $100,000 – $500,000+
4. Compliance Packages
- Basic compliance audit: $5,000 – $25,000
- Full corporate compliance program: $50,000 – $250,000
Factors Affecting Cost
- Industry type (healthcare, finance, e-commerce)
- Data sensitivity level
- Number of customers affected
- Legal jurisdiction complexity
How to Choose the Best Cybersecurity Law Firm in the USA
Choosing the right firm is critical for legal protection and compliance.
1. Industry Expertise
Look for firms with experience in your industry:
- Healthcare → HIPAA compliance experts
- Finance → SEC cybersecurity regulations
- E-commerce → PCI-DSS compliance
2. Cybersecurity Knowledge
A strong cybersecurity law firm should understand:
- Network security principles
- Cloud computing risks
- Encryption standards
- Incident response systems
3. Regulatory Experience
Ensure the firm has experience with:
- Federal laws
- State privacy laws
- International compliance frameworks
4. Response Time
Cyber incidents require immediate legal action. Choose firms offering:
- 24/7 emergency response
- Dedicated incident response teams
5. Reputation & Track Record
Check:
- Case history
- Client reviews
- Industry recognition

FAQ – USA Cybersecurity Law Firm Services
1. What does a cybersecurity lawyer do?
A cybersecurity lawyer handles legal issues related to data protection, cybercrime, compliance, and digital risk management.
2. Do small businesses need cybersecurity law firms?
Yes. Small businesses are often targeted by cyberattacks and still must comply with privacy laws.
3. How much does a cybersecurity attorney cost in the USA?
Costs range from $250 to $1,500 per hour depending on expertise and case complexity.
4. What laws do cybersecurity firms handle?
They handle HIPAA, GDPR, CCPA, SOX, and other data privacy regulations.
5. What happens after a data breach?
A cybersecurity law firm helps investigate the breach, notify affected users, and manage legal risks.
6. Is cybersecurity law the same as IT security?
No. IT security focuses on technology protection, while cybersecurity law focuses on legal compliance and liability.
7. Can a cybersecurity law firm prevent hacking?
They cannot prevent hacking directly but help reduce risk through compliance, policies, and legal safeguards.
